Cache invalidation for the Fernwick catalog service runs on a 15-minute sweep plus event-driven purges triggered by SKU updates. Purge requests are signed and verified before the edge layer accepts them; unsigned requests are dropped and logged. Note that manual purges bypass the audit queue, which is a known gap. The full invalidation flow and trust boundaries are diagrammed on the internal page here.

runbook for badug-kadup: https://confluence.zemvarlabs.internal/projects/browse/display/projects/bd1b

## Service Accounts — StormFan Alert Fan-Out

The fan-out worker authenticates to the internal dispatch tier using the svc-stormfan account. Rotate quarterly; scopes are limited to publish-only on alert topics. If deliveries stall during your shift, verify the worker is using the current credential, reproduced below for reference.

API key for kaweg-hahif: kto4_rAjZ

## Local Setup

Welcome aboard! SquatterSniff scans our registry mirror for typo-squatting package names (think "requessts" nonsense). Clone the repo, run `make bootstrap`, and seed the sample package index with `make seed`. The scanner needs a local results database to store match scores and flagged names. Point it at the dev instance using the connection string below.

replica DSN, kajep-yahag: mssql://praok_svc:iF@db-8d68.plorvaio.local:5432/eliion